The wine
This Chardonnay comes from one-hundred-year old vines grown on red marly soil. Its vinification in barriques and its 22-month élevage on lees in demi-muids gives it a round and rather creamy character, counterbalanced by fine tension. It is fruity on the nose (ripe stone fruit, citrus fruit) and spicy. Its persistence means it pairs beautifully with a mature Comté or roast meat with fruit.
About the Producer Ganevat (domaine)
Former head winemaker of Jean-Marc Morey in Chassagne-Montrachet, Jean-François Gavenat has become one of the most talented winemakers in the Jura since he took over his family estate in 1998. Located in Rotalier in the hamlet of La Combe, the vineyard spans 13 hectares and includes many different grape varieties. Gavenat has a natural and biodynamic approach (without certification) and produces some single vineyard wines (the estate boasts 50 different cuvées). The vines are relatively old and meticulously cared for. The yields are low and the vinifcations gentle. Some of the reds are matured in amphorae are of a very high quality.
The property’s grande cuvée is Les Vignes de mon Père, a Savagnin aged for ten years.
Jean-François Gavenat has also set up a small négociant business with his wife under the name ‘Anne et Jean-François Ganevat’, which allows him to produce and offer even more wines to the world. This estate has played an important part in increasing the popularity of wines from the Jura. Production is small and the wines are prized by wine lovers all over.
